Dashboard Overview
The dashboard is your central hub for monitoring AI visibility across all your brands. It provides quick access to metrics, reports, and actions.
Main Dashboard Elements
Brand Cards
Each brand you track appears as a card showing:
- Brand name and logo (if configured)
- Primary website being tracked
- Key metrics: Appearance rate, visibility score, average position
- Trend indicator: Whether metrics are improving or declining
Click any brand card to access its detailed report.
Quick Stats
At the top of the dashboard, you'll see aggregate statistics:
- Total brands you're tracking
- Total prompts being monitored
- Average visibility across all brands
- Recent changes summary

Dashboard Actions
Creating a New Brand
From the dashboard, click "Add Brand" to start tracking a new brand. You'll be guided through:
- Entering brand details
- Adding websites
- Setting up topics and prompts
Accessing Reports
Click on any brand card or use Reports in the navigation to view detailed visibility data.
Quick Actions
Each brand card includes quick action buttons:
- View Report: Open the full brand report
- Settings: Access brand configuration
- Recommendations: Jump to suggestions
